[url]http://powerupgaming.co.uk/articles/493-microsoft-working-on-beloved-strategy-game[/url] [quote]Microsoft Game Studios are currently developing the 'next installment in a beloved strategy game franchise', according to a number of listings on their careers site. According to the posts, the company's Decisive Games team, which 'is focused on world class strategy game development', is hiring three senior software engineers to work on its latest project. The job listings go on to request applicants with 'familiarity of Direct X11 or Xbox 360/Xbox One rendering APIs', effectively confirming a release on both PC and Xbox consoles.[/quote] AoE IV?
